CVE-2026-58159 is a high-severity incorrect authorization vulnerability in Apache Traffic Server caused by flaws in listener handling and ACL matching. The issue allows IP-based access controls to be bypassed on Unix Domain Socket listeners and also permits authorization bypass through ACL matching errors. Affected versions are Apache Traffic Server 8.0.0 through 8.1.9, 9.0.0 through 9.2.14, and 10.0.0 through 10.1.3.
